Azure Power Wins 200 MW Solar Power Project in Gujarat

Azure Power (NYSE: AZRE), a leading independent solar power
producer in India, announced that it has won a 200 MW solar project
in Gujarat. With this win, the Company now has a total portfolio of
~470 MWs in Gujarat with Gujarat Urja Vikas Nigam Limited (GUVNL),
making Azure Power the largest solar power supplier to the state.
GUVNL has been rated AA- by ICRA, a Moody’s company, which is one
of the highest rated state counterparties in India.

Azure Power will sign a 25 year Power Purchase Agreement (PPA)
with GUVNL, at a tariff of INR 3.06 (~US$ 0.05) per kWh, which is
25% higher than the lowest tariff of INR 2.44 (~US$ 0.04) in the
Indian solar market. The project will be developed by Azure Power
outside a solar park and is expected to be commissioned in 2019.
Azure Power has a long history of developing and operating solar
power plants under the Gujarat Solar Policy 2009. Some of the first
solar projects in India were built in Gujarat, given several
advantages the state has including high levels of solar radiation,
an extensive and stable electric grid network, and the strong
credit quality of its DISCOMs. Azure Power developed and is
operating India’s first MW-scale distributed solar rooftop project
in Gujarat’s state capital city, Gandhinagar. In 2013, World Bank
recognized this project as one of the Top 10 public-private
partnerships in the Asia Pacific region.

About Azure Power
Azure Power (NYSE: AZRE) is a leading independent solar power
with a pan-Indian portfolio. With its in-house engineering,
procurement and construction expertise and advanced in-house
operations and maintenance capability, Azure Power provides
low-cost and reliable solar power solutions to customers throughout
India. It has developed, constructed and operated solar projects of
varying sizes, from utility scale, rooftop to mini & micro
grids, since its inception in 2008. Highlights include the
construction of India’s first private utility scale solar PV power
plant in 2009 and the implementation of the first MW scale rooftop
project under the smart city initiative in 2013.
